Re: Recommended Wii Games

Suggestions: Mario Party 8 definitely for any party. Extremely fun in groups. Mario & Sonic at the Olympics is great for people who like track and have a competitive nature. Wario Ware, Guitar Hero III because it is fun, and great for the wii. Mario Strikers charged is fun and possibly wii play
